Director 6 uses an integer value to store information about
the amount
of available memory (real and virtual) on the current
machine. The
problem with that is that some modern computers have
"too much" memory
and the value exceeds the maximum integer value and wraps
negative,
resulting in the memory error you described. The only way to
fix this is
to either (a) reduce the amount of memory on the user's
machine to avoid
the issue, or (b) republish using at least Director 7 as we
converted to
a floating point value in order to fix this issue.
